Abstract(in English) Driving environment recognition technologies are key technologies for ITS. So far, various methods to recognize of lane markers on roads and preceding vehicles are proposed because these methods are important for the driving environments recognition. Authors are studying lane and vehicle recognition using an edge histogram method which projects edge shading values obtained by an in-vehicle camera. This paper describes various lane recognition methods and proposes new edge histogram method using color information.
